QUESTION:

Problem 5Q

Will a nearsighted person who wears corrective lenses in her glasses be able to see clearly underwater when wearing those glasses? Use a diagram to show why or why not.

ANSWER:

Step-by-step solution

Step 1 of 2

APPROACH

In nearsightedness, the eye can focus only nearby objects and the distant objects are not seen clearly. A diverging lens causes parallel rays to diverge which allow the rays to be focused at retina and thus corrects the defect.
